1.2  Vehicle Check: Before Your Trip, you have to ensure that the means of your transport is in good shape. Be it your car, bus, or van. You don’t need any malfunctions or breakdowns of the vehicle conveying you. Inspect your vehicles including; brakes, fluids, tires, engines, all internal and external lights, spare tires and the like. After having all these checks you are good to go.

Also to ensure your vehicle is roadworthy, while on the trip, you can find reliable mechanics along your routes. 

 For advice on trustworthy mechanics, consult the National or Regional Automobile Association, also enlist the help of locales by asking them for reliable mechanics and online reviews like Google Review for a good recommendation.

6 Safety First

6.1 Driving Responsibilities: Make sure you observe traffic regulations and speed limits. Also take regular breaks, by stopping to rest, and drinking a lot of water, and you could also share the driving responsibilities where you and the people with you can take turns in driving.


6.2 Emergency Contact: You must have a list of emergency contacts readily available. You can also inform someone about your trip and its itineraries.

 

Designed by freepik www.freepik.com

6.3 GPS Tracker and Safety Apps: It is important to have a GPS Tracker and Safety Apps to ensure security. Here are more reasons why it is important;

 

  • Real-Time Location Tracking: Realtime location information is provided by the GPS tracker, enabling your family to know where you are in case of an emergency and ensuring that they can reach you.


  • Emergency Assistance: Safety apps come with features, such as the SOS button that is designed to notify authorities or emergency contacts of your situation and location quickly when you activate them.


  • Safe Driving Features: Some of the safety apps include features for promoting good driver behaviour, such as speed limit alerts, traffic reports and reminders to be careful behind the wheel.
